Comprehensive insights into sepsis-induced cardiac dysfunction through proteomics and metabolomics
Ontology highlight
ABSTRACT: The CLP mice were utilized as a model in this study to investigate the impact of septic cardiomyopathy on the molecular changes in heart tissues through combining metabolomics and proteomics studies. This work adds to our understanding of the implications of sepsis-induced cardiac dysfunction and may lead to identifying novel potential biomarkers and a better understanding of sepsis pathophysiology.
